James Gar Mink

James Gar Mink, 83, of Elizabethtown, died Tuesday, July 2, 2019 at his home. He was born in Rockcastle County, KY, and was a self-employed carpenter. He was a very dedicated member, deacon, and hard worker for First Interdenominational Church. He was preceded in death by his wife, Anna Sanders Mink; two sons, James Edward "Eddie" Mink and Steve Gar Mink; parents, James Garfield and Mattie Parrett Mink; a sister, Laura Virginia Cromer; and four brothers, Carter, George, David, and Wesley Mink. He is survived by two daughters, Donna (Leroy) Routt and Judy (Rory) Ward all of Elizabethtown; a brother, Harvey C. Mink (Mary Ellen) of Elizabethtown; a sister, Vivian Murphy; two grandchildren, Anna J. Routt of Gainesville, FL. and Nicole Ward of Elizabethtown; and three great grandchildren, Lilian McGlone, Logan Dieckmann, and Rosalyn Williamson. The funeral is at 2 p.m. Friday at Brown Funeral Home with Bro. Leroy Routt officiating. Burial will follow in Valley Creek Cemetery. Visitation is from 9 a.m. to 2 p.m. Friday at the funeral home.
